Eritrea: New micro-dam being constructed in Keren vis-à-vis infrastructural facility for prevention of alluvial deposit

Keren, 25 January 2014 – The Administration of Anseba region pointed out that a new micro-dam is being constructed in Dearit area vis-à-vis infrastructural facility for prevention of alluvial deposit in a bid to ensuring sustainable water supply for Keren city.

Mr. Zerigaber Hidrai, Acting head of engineering services and project management in the Administrative office, disclosed that the construction of the micro-dam capable of impounding more than 400,000 cubic meters of water has gained momentum in line with the funding on the part of the Administration and popular input involving participation of members of the People’s Army. He further pointed out that stepped-up efforts are being exerted to finalize the task next month, and that previous construction of such micro-dams in the area last year could give rise to more water supply and reinforcement of irrigation farming.

Engineering activities in this connection pose challenges in the region as it is rather characterized by mountainous topography and susceptibility to quick sedimentation of rocks, while substantial experience has been acquired as regards coping with the quandaries of this type.

Reports indicate that the latest micro-dam bears potential for irrigating a total area of 100 hectares.
